THE ATTOLINI LAMP AA7

About

Antonio Attolini Lack was a visionary Mexican architect known for his bold modernist language and deep sensitivity to space, material, and ritual. With a career rooted in Mexico City, his work bridged architecture and object, scale and intimacy — shaping environments with a sculptural, almost spiritual clarity. The pieces presented here reflect his lesser-known yet powerful explorations in furniture and object design, where form becomes both functional and architectural gesture.

Design
The Attolini AA7 Lamp reflects a modernist clarity that feels both timeless and grounded. Reissued by Clásicos Mexicanos, it embodies Attolini’s architectural sensibility — where function and form are treated with equal precision. Lampshade is included in the design.
Year
1970
Dimensions
Ø: 13,77 x 13,77 in
Materials +
  • Hand molded stoneware
  • Grey glaze-fabric lamp shade
